Splash parks across North Herts are set to reopen for the spring season.

The four parks in Baldock, Hitchin, Letchworth, and Royston will open daily from 10am to 6pm, starting on Saturday, May 3.

They will remain open until Sunday, September 7.

Alan North, greenspace service manager at North Herts Council, said: "We’re excited to be coming into the splashpad season, we know they are popular throughout the district.

"We just hope we keep this lovely weather."

The park kiosks in Hitchin's Bancroft Recreation Ground and Letchworth's Howard Park will also be open, serving hot and cold drinks, snacks, and ice cream.

Mr North added: "Bancroft and Howard Park are great places to welcome spring with a hot drink and perhaps a treat, whether you’re taking the kids to the park or are just going for a walk."

The Letchworth Lido is also set to reopen on May 24.

It will remain open until September 7.

The Hitchin outdoor pool will open on May 10, with cold water until May 23.

The normal season will run from May 24 to September 7, with cold water again from September 8 to September 21.
